ηθική
See also: ἠθική
Greek
Etymology
From Ancient Greek ἠθική (ēthikḗ), feminine nominative/vocative singular of ἠθικός (ēthikós): "of/for/pertaining to morals, moral, expressive of character".
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/i.θiˈci/
